Mario Kart 8 balanced "thousands of times" during development, two Rainbow Roads added

Mario Kart 8 producer Hideki Konno has said the latest entry in the series will reward players for their mad karting skills, not luck.

Speaking in a roundtable interview attended by Gamespot, Konno said the gameplay and items have been balanced "thousands of times, maybe even tens of thousands of times" before the felt things were satisfactory.

"We do hear, and a lot of people out there say it, that Mario Kart is all about luck," he said. "That if you're at the front then you'll get hit with a blue shell, so it's all about luck. That feature is not random - it doesn't just happen.

"There is a lot of adjustment and there is a lot of thought and effort put into that system, and developing it in a way that actually promotes game balance. I would hope people understand that as well."

The game's director Kosuke Yabuki added during the interview that two Rainbow Road courses will be added: one based on the final level in Mario Kart N64 and an all-new course.

Earlier today, new information and screenshots were released for the title, which lands on May 30.
